Item 8.01. Other Events.

On January 20, 2016, the Board of Directors (the “Board”) of Capital Southwest Corporation (the “Company”) authorized a new share repurchase program for up to $10 million of its outstanding common stock. Pursuant to the repurchase program, the Company may acquire up to $10 million of its outstanding common stock at prices below its net asset value per share as reported in its then most recently published financial statements. The Company may utilize various methods to effect the repurchases, which could include open market or negotiated transactions, including through Rule 10b5-1 plans. The timing, prices, and sizes of repurchases will depend upon prevailing market prices, general economic and market conditions, and other considerations. The repurchase program will be in effect until the approved dollar amount has been used to repurchase shares or the Board amends or discontinues the plan at any time.
